Discussion Pondering a possible rebirth of the Access Virus line
I've been watching with great interest as the recent update to the free, open-source plugin Neural Amp Modeler has been making the rounds. The new A2 version has been comparing VERY well against the expensive hardware amp modelers like the Quad Cortex, the Helix, and the one most relevant to this post, the Kemper Profiler line. IMO, this new NAM release has the potential to cut the legs out from under the expensive proprietary modelers, particularly as more and more low-cost pedals capable of running the NAM A2 code appear on the market, and as the sheer number of free amp and IR models for NAM continues to increase.
With these latest developments in mind, I wonder if Christoph Kemper might be feeling encouraged to start giving more attention to Access, possibly in the form of new Virus products, or even completely new and novel non-VA synths. I can't speak for anyone else, but I'd love to see Christoph back in the synth world again. What does everyone else think?

What Should I Buy? Cheaper poly options - Brand new Pro 800, Used Dreadbox Nymphes or other?
After years of bashing random keys and hoping for the best, I’ve invested time into learning music theory. Whilst it has been great practicing on smaller budget paraphonic gear and learning to build and write more complex chord progressions and such, i‘ve realised it’s time for a polyphonic synth.
Looking at not spending a lot, I’m eyeing up either;
- A brand new Pro-800 which can be had for £209 delivered to my door on Thomann.
- Trying to snag a Dreadbox Nymphes for around £300-£350 on eBay.
I own a Dreadbox Typhon and absolutely love it, it travels with me and I love what it can do and from what I’ve seen/heard I’d like the Nymphes, although the shift function menu’s and tweaking may take some getting used to. The Pro-800 however, has two extra voices and is a third cheaper, although I believe it has some issues at launch that may have been resolved in updates.
I own an Arturia Keystep 37 so a synth with a keyboard isn’t a must.
Anyone that owns them both, or either, or has any experience have any advice?
